libs-gui/Documentation/gsdoc/NSScroller.html

295 lines
11 KiB
HTML
Raw Normal View History

<html>
<head>
<title>NSScroller</title>
</head>
<body>
<a href="Gui.html">Up</a>
<br />
<h1><a name="title$NSScroller">NSScroller</a></h1>
<h3>Authors</h3>
<dl>
<dt>Ovidiu Predescu(<a href="mailto:ovidiu@net-community.com"><code>
ovidiu@net-community.com
</code></a>)</dt>
<dd>
</dd>
<dt>Felipe A. Rodriguez(<a href="mailto:far@ix.netcom.com"><code>
far@ix.netcom.com
</code></a>)</dt>
<dd>
</dd>
<dt>Richard Frith-Macdonald(<a href="mailto:richard@brainstorm.co.uk"><code>
richard@brainstorm.co.uk
</code></a>)</dt>
<dd>
</dd>
</dl>
<p><b>Copyright:</b> (C) 1996 Free Software Foundation, Inc.</p>
<div>
<hr width="50%" align="left" />
<h3>Contents -</h3>
<ol>
<li>
<a href="#001000000000">Software documentation for the NSScroller class</a>
</li>
</ol>
<hr width="50%" align="left" />
</div>
<h1><a name="001000000000">
Software documentation for the NSScroller class
</a></h1>
<h2><a name="class$NSScroller">NSScroller</a> : <a rel="gsdoc" href="NSControl.html#class$NSControl">NSControl</a></h2>
<blockquote>
<dl>
<dt><b>Declared in:</b></dt>
<dd>AppKit/NSScroller.h</dd>
</dl>
</blockquote>
<blockquote>
<dl>
<dt><b>Conforms to:</b></dt>
<dd><a rel="gsdoc" href="/usr/GNUstep-devel/System/Documentation/Base/NSObject.html#protocol$(NSCoding)">NSCoding</a></dd>
</dl>
</blockquote>
<blockquote>
<b>Standards:</b>
<ul>
<li>GNUstep</li>
<li>MacOS-X</li>
<li>OpenStep</li>
</ul>
</blockquote>
<p>
<em>Description forthcoming.</em>
</p>
<b>Method summary</b>
<ul>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ller+scrollerWidth">+scrollerWidth</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ller+scrollerWidthForControlSize:">+scrollerWidthForControlSize: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-arrowsPosition">-arrowsPosition</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-checkSpaceForParts">-checkSpaceForParts</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-controlSize">-controlSize</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-controlTint">-controlTint</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-drawArrow:highlight:">-drawArrow:highlight: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-drawKnob">-drawKnob</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-drawKnobSlot">-drawKnobSlot</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-drawParts">-drawParts</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-highlight:">-highlight: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-hitPart">-hitPart</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-knobProportion">-knobProportion</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-rectForPart:">-rectForPart: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-setArrowsPosition:">-setArrowsPosition: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-setControlSize:">-setControlSize: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-setControlTint:">-setControlTint: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-setFloatValue:knobProportion:">-setFloatValue:knobProportion: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-testPart:">-testPart: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-trackKnob:">-trackKnob: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-trackScrollButtons:">-trackScrollButtons:</a></li>
<li><a rel="gsdoc" href="NSScroller.html#method$NSScroller-usableParts">-usableParts</a></li>
</ul>
<hr width="50%" align="left" />
<h3><a name="method$NSScroller+scrollerWidth">scrollerWidth</a></h3>
+ (float) <b>scrollerWidth</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ller+scrollerWidthForControlSize:">scrollerWidthForControlSize:</a></h3>
+ (float) <b>scrollerWidthForControlSize:</b> (NSControlSize)controlSize;<br />
<b>Standards:</b> NotOpenStep, GNUstep, MacOS-X<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-arrowsPosition">arrowsPosition</a></h3>
- (NSScrollArrowPosition) <b>arrowsPosition</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-checkSpaceForParts">checkSpaceForParts</a></h3>
- (void) <b>checkSpaceForParts</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-controlSize">controlSize</a></h3>
- (NSControlSize) <b>controlSize</b>;<br />
<b>Standards:</b> NotOpenStep, GNUstep, MacOS-X<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-controlTint">controlTint</a></h3>
- (NSControlTint) <b>controlTint</b>;<br />
<b>Standards:</b> NotOpenStep, GNUstep, MacOS-X<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-drawArrow:highlight:">drawArrow:highlight:</a></h3>
- (void) <b>drawArrow:</b> (NSScrollerArrow)whichButton<b> highlight:</b> (BOOL)flag;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-drawKnob">drawKnob</a></h3>
- (void) <b>drawKnob</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-drawKnobSlot">drawKnobSlot</a></h3>
- (void) <b>drawKnobSlot</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-drawParts">drawParts</a></h3>
- (void) <b>drawParts</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-highlight:">highlight:</a></h3>
- (void) <b>highlight:</b> (BOOL)flag;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-hitPart">hitPart</a></h3>
- (NSScrollerPart) <b>hitPart</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-knobProportion">knobProportion</a></h3>
- (float) <b>knobProportion</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-rectForPart:">rectForPart:</a></h3>
- (NSRect) <b>rectForPart:</b> (NSScrollerPart)partCode;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-setArrowsPosition:">setArrowsPosition:</a></h3>
- (void) <b>setArrowsPosition:</b> (NSScrollArrowPosition)where;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-setControlSize:">setControlSize:</a></h3>
- (void) <b>setControlSize:</b> (NSControlSize)controlSize;<br />
<b>Standards:</b> NotOpenStep, GNUstep, MacOS-X<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-setControlTint:">setControlTint:</a></h3>
- (void) <b>setControlTint:</b> (NSControlTint)controlTint;<br />
<b>Standards:</b> NotOpenStep, GNUstep, MacOS-X<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-setFloatValue:knobProportion:">setFloatValue:knobProportion:</a></h3>
- (void) <b>setFloatValue:</b> (float)aFloat<b> knobProportion:</b> (float)ratio;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-testPart:">testPart:</a></h3>
- (NSScrollerPart) <b>testPart:</b> (NSPoint)thePoint;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-trackKnob:">trackKnob:</a></h3>
- (void) <b>trackKnob:</b> (<a rel="gsdoc" href="NSEvent.html#class$NSEvent">NSEvent</a>*)theEvent;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-trackScrollButtons:">trackScrollButtons:</a></h3>
- (void) <b>trackScrollButtons:</b> (<a rel="gsdoc" href="NSEvent.html#class$NSEvent">NSEvent</a>*)theEvent;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<h3><a name="method$NSScroller-usableParts">usableParts</a></h3>
- (NSUsableScrollerParts) <b>usableParts</b>;<br />
<b>Standards:</b> GNUstep, MacOS-X, OpenStep<br />
<p>
<em>Description forthcoming.</em>
</p>
<hr width="25%" align="left" />
<br />
<a href="Gui.html">Up</a>
</body>
</html>